Alacrity (n) |
To do s.t with alacrity (enthusiasm) |
|
Prosaic (adj) |
The prosaic side of life (mundane) |
|
Veracity (n)- veracious (adj) |
To question the veracity of a story (truthfulness) |
|
Paucity (n) |
A paucity of job (lack of) |
|
Maintain (v) |
To maintain a claim (assert) |
|
Contrite (adj) |
To look contrite (remorseful)- a look of contrition |
|
Laconic (adj) |
A laconic comment (with few words) |
|
Pugnacious (adj) |
To answer pugnaciously (verbally competitive) |
|
Disparate (adj) - disparity (n) |
Two things are disparate (different)- the wide disparity between rich and poor |
|
Egregious (adj) |
Egregious behaviour (extremely bad) |
|
Innocuous (adj) |
An innocuous question (harmless) |
|
Candid (adj) |
To be candid, I ... (Candour) |
|
Erratic (adj) |
Erratic behaviour/ rainfall (unpredictable) |
|
Bleak (adj) |
A bleak landscape (empty)- the future looks bleak for industy |
|
Profuse (adj) |
Profuse bleeding/ apologies (produced in large amounts) |
|
Extant (adj) |
Extant remains of s.t (existent) |
|
Contentious (adj) |
A contentious topic/ meeting (like to argue) |
|
Auspicious ( adj)- inauspicious |
An auspicious start (promising) |
|
Enervate (v) |
An enervating disease/climate (making weak and tired) |
|
Equivocate (v) - equivocal (adj) |
Seem to be equivocating (speak vaguely)- s.t is equivocal (ambiguous) |
|
Ambivalent (about/towards s.t) (adj) |
An ambivalent attitude towards s.t (both good and bad feeling) |
|
Sedulous (adj) |
Sedulous attention to details (diligent- showing great effort) |
